book cover of Two And Twenty Dark TalesShort Story: Wee Willie Winkie
Author: Leigh Fallon
Anthology: Two And Twenty Dark Tales

Summary: Wee Willie Winkie is a dark retelling of the Mother Goose Rhyme of the same name.

My thoughts:  Wee Willie Winkie is one of the scarier stories in this collection.  It’s not your typical creepy story but it has a very haunting feel to it.  The setting, the characters, and the writing all give it that spooky air.  However, while I enjoyed the creepiness of it, I felt that it was a tad to short for me to truly love it.  I would have liked just a bit more to the story.

Overall, Wee Willie Winkie is one of the better short stories in this collection.  I will definitely be checking out more of Leigh Fallon’s work in the future.
